Below is the blurb I found on the net.
the last gevarm 8 and 20 round magazines and guns(e2 export models) were made and imported into canada in 1990. The factory has since quit production in france. the e2 export model was the only one they made for export before closing down. they also made 5 and 10 round magazines.all of these magazines had to be fitted to the guns because of the different models that were produced.

Gevarm magazines fit the venturini open bolt 22 . Gevarm made their own locally.
A Gevarm is class 5 military in France. That is why they closed down.
All of the models were available for export at the time of closing.
But, most people wanted E1 and E1 export models. So that's why other importers and I brought
them in. The only magazine's they made available were 8 rd and 20 rd for 22lr rifles
